Researchers at a community-based teaching hospital faced a significant challenge: they needed vital signs and lab results for a chart review, but their electronic medical record (EMR) system could not export the data in a clean, analysis-ready format. The manual alternative—transcribing data from individual patient records—would have been prohibitively slow. Their solution was to use Excel. They developed two custom macros (automated procedures) using Visual Basic for Applications (VBA). These macros dramatically streamlined the process of sorting and compiling messy datasets.
